Output 956cc60bebc1f2413106ed2ae169140268ffaf6a49dbb51bf0fda67bb0b55257:10

value
6500276433
script pubkey
OP_0 OP_PUSHBYTES_32 de2b538ef552b114834e2a69c291436a2b259ae3cc3b5b6dac8888ca7aabe210
address
bc1qmc448rh422c3fq6w9f5u9y2rdg4jtxhresa4kmdv3zyv574tuggqe89vfc
transaction
956cc60bebc1f2413106ed2ae169140268ffaf6a49dbb51bf0fda67bb0b55257
confirmations
158288
spent
true